Aplugin-basedserverforrunningfakeHTTPandsocketservices(especiallySOAservice)usingPython.
_ (`-. _ .-') .-. .-') ( (OO ) ( \( -O ) \ ( OO ) _.` \ ,------.,------. .-'),-----. .-----. ,--. ,--.(__...--''('-| _.---'| /`. '( OO' .-. ' ' .--./ | .' / | / | |(OO|(_\ | / | |/ | | | | | |('-. | /, | |_.' |/ | '--. | |_.' |\_) | |\| | /_) |OO )| ' _) | .___.'\_)| .--' | . '.' \ | | | | || |`-'| | . \ | | \| |_) | |\ \ `' '-' '(_' '--'\ | |\ \ `--' `--' `--' '--' `-----' `-----' `--' '--'requirementspython>=2.7
开发进度dev(developbranch):0.2.5
master(stablebranch):0.2.5
Englishreadmehttps://github.com/knightliao/pfrock/blob/master/README-en.md
主要目标为微服务架构(SOA)而生。
可以mock微服务架构(SOA)中各式各样的服务接口请求
统一的代理服务入口。通过提供统一的router入口,用户不必一个一个接口的去对接mock.统一接入代理服务即可.
强大的功能
配置文件式设计,零开发成本
更改配置文件,无须重启,自动生效
输入自定义匹配url,method(GET/POST/PUT/DELETE/HEAD);输出自定义静态文件/静态目录/动态handler/header
开放式设计
插件式开发,即插即用,为可扩展性提供良好支持。目前系统核心已经支持静态/动态/自定义的Mock服务能力
开放性,利用python动态能力,可以与各种中间件交互,登录redis/Q/db/hadoop
评论